The Anatomy of an Interactive Opera PartyA typical interactive opera event balances education with pure entertainment. The celebration often begins with a live, up-close performance by professional singers to set a captivating mood. Once the ice is broken, the focus shifts to guest participation. Attendees might learn a famous chorale from Bizet’s Carmen or a dramatic ensemble piece from Mozart’s The Marriage of Figaro. Guests are introduced to the concepts of operatic staging, learning how to convey intense emotions through large gestures and powerful posture. The experience balances structured learning with spontaneous laughter as friends and family discover the hidden power of their own voices.
Custom Arias and Personalized PlotsOne of the most compelling aspects of a hands-on opera birthday is customization. Organizers often collaborate with librettists to write a short, comedic operatic scene based entirely on the guest of honor’s life. Everyday anecdotes, inside jokes, and personal milestones are rewritten into grand poetic verses. Guests are assigned specific roles, from the dramatic hero to the mischievous chorus. Performing a personalized opera ensures the birthday person feels uniquely celebrated, transforming their personal history into legendary myth wrapped in beautiful melodies.
